原创 內存對齊(一)

   昨天做騰訊的筆試題,有兩道是內存對齊問題,之前也看過,不過理解不夠深刻,今天看了下前人總結,也小小的總結一下. 首先說說爲什麼要有內存對齊 1.內存對齊原因:   (1):平臺原因:不是所有的硬件平臺都能訪問任意地址的的任意數據的,

原创 編程之美---子矩陣之和的最大值

把二維轉化爲一維,再利用求最大子序列的方法求最大子矩陣. #include<stdio.h> #include<stdlib.h> #include<string.h> #include<assert.h> #define max(a,

原创 編程之美---求數組的子數組之和的最大值

最大字段和問題,不分析了,就是一個動態規劃 #include<stdio.h> #include<stdlib.h> #include<assert.h> #define max(a, b) ((a) > (b) ? (a) : (b)

原创 Writing MySQL Scripts with Python DB-API

Writing MySQL Scripts with Python DB-API Paul [email protected] Document revision: 1.02 Last update: 2006-

原创 C++中各種類型的成員變量的初始化方法

c++各種不同類型成員根據是否static 、時候const類型的初始化方法不盡相同,java的語法就沒有這麼複雜,怪的得那麼多人都跑去學Java了。以前面試時被人問到這個問題回答不出來,寫代碼時也經常搞亂了,這裏翻了下書,總結一下。

原创 到此爲止

   本博客不會再更新了,已轉移。。。

原创 並行算法之前綴和

#include<stdio.h> #include<stdlib.h> #include<fcntl.h> #include<pthread.h> #include<math.h> #include<time.h> int threa

原创 hadoop 集羣默認配置和常用配置

獲取默認配置 配置hadoop,主要是配置core-site.xml,hdfs-site.xml,mapred-site.xml三個配置文件,默認下來,這些配置文件都是空的,所以很難知道這些配置文件有哪些配置可以生效,上網找的配置可能因

原创 Kahan summation

原文:http://www.myexception.cn/other/969340.html Kahan求和公式原理:        首先,這個算法就是用來求和的,求a1+a2+a3+...爲什麼不直接相加呢,而要用Kahan求和公式呢,

原创 gdb文檔

gdb(1)                             GNU Tools                            gdb(1) NAME        gdb - The G

原创 DataMining-Experiment1

#include <iostream> #include <stdio.h> #include <stdlib.h> #include <fstream> #include <cmath> #include <vector> #inclu

原创 常用的gdb調試命令

小結:常用的gdb命令       backtrace   顯示程序中的當前位置和表示如何到達當前位置的棧跟蹤(同義詞:where)       breakpoint   在程序中設置一個斷點       cd   改變當前工作目錄

原创 終於把hadoop的環境搭建好了

    昨天一天加今天一上午,終於把環境搭建起來了,hadoop太複雜了,好麻煩,這絕對是我會編程以來,搭建環境最麻煩的一次,沒有之一。。。    看到運行的wordcount程序,心情真是大好

原创 第一個只出現一次的字符

#include<stdio.h> #include<string.h> #include<assert.h> unsigned int hashTable[256]; char queue[256]; char solve(char

原创

     找實習真煩,至今只投了微軟,百度和騰訊,微軟筆試未過就比較sad,騰訊筆試後沒通知,可能也是被刷,百度二面後沒信了,很sad...我最理想的三家公司...看來還得繼續閉關,把項目完善一下了...